Dumbbell Incline Alternate Fly

The alternating dumbbell incline fly emphasizes the upper chest and improves unilateral control without requiring heavy loads.

How to perform

§ 02 · Steps
  1. 01

    Set an incline bench to 30–45 degrees and lie back with the dumbbells held above your chest. Pull your shoulder blades back and down, and keep a slight bend in your elbows.

  2. 02

    Brace your core and slowly lower one dumbbell out to the side in an arc until you feel a stretch in your chest, without letting your shoulder rise toward your ear.

  3. 03

    Return the dumbbell above your chest and squeeze your chest, keeping your wrist in a neutral position.

  4. 04

    Lower the other dumbbell along the same path, alternating sides for each repetition.

Tips

§ 04 · Tips

Keep the bend in your elbows nearly the same throughout the movement and avoid turning the exercise into a press. Keep your shoulder blades together throughout the entire set, and stop the range of motion before your shoulder starts to roll forward.
